Division 2A – Tullysaran 0-12 Pearse Og 0-8

In the first ever meeting between these sides at senior level, Tullysaran earned a four-point win over Pearse Og in their Division 2A clash.

After a scrappy start, Tullysaran led through points from Mark McKeever and Ciaran O’Riordan before the Ogs got off the mark.

McKeever added a second while Eddie Mallon also pointed to see the home side carry a 4-3 advantage into the second half.

The Ogs levelled the game straight from the throw in, but Tullysaran soon got their noses ahead once again.

Mark McKenna hit two while two great saves from Kevin Hayes prevented the Ogs from rattling the net.

Tullysaran recorded the next four scores via Ryan Conlon, Gavin Conlon and two excellent long-range scores from McKeever.

The sides traded scores late in the game, with McKeever and Gavin Conlon splitting the posts for the victors.

Division 2A Round Up

Elsewhere in the division, St Paul’s earned their third win on the trot, edging past Culloville by one-point, 0-10 to 0-9.

Carrickcruppen proved too strong for Wolfe Tones and secured a three-point win in the end, 0-13 to 1-7.

Cullyhanna continued their winning streak, defeating Tir na nOg away from home by four-points, 0-12 to 0-8.

Division 2B – Whitecross 3-15 Forkhill 0-12

Aidan Finnegan, Neil McSherry and Cormac Mulligan all netted for Whitecross as they continued their perfect start to the season.

Whitecross picked up their third victory of the campaign, seeing off Forkhill with a dominant second half display.

Finnegan’s first half major had the hosts ahead at the break, 1-6 to 0-6, with Cormac Toner hitting 0-5 of Forkhill’s tally.

McSherry and Mulligan added three-pointers after the turnaround as Whitecross ran out 12-point winners.
